description C-banding was used to study the variations in heterochromatic block markings in chromosomes of Anopheles darlingi and A. nuneztovari from Manaus, State of Amazonas, and Macapá, State of Amapá, Brazil. Both species had two differently shaped X chromosomes and a Y chromosome that was entirely heterochromatic. The X1 chromosome of A. darlingi had markings that extended 1/3 of the total length whereas in the X2 chromosome the markings were located around the centromeric region. The markings on autosomal chromosomes were concentrated in the centromeric region in both species, with a heterochromatic block in one arm of chromosome II of A. darlingi. A. nuneztovari had three heterochromatic blocks in chromosome X1 (longer) and two blocks in X2 (shorter). X2X2 females were not detected in either species. The X1 and X2 chromosomes of males were found in A. darlingi, whereas in A. nuneztovari only the X1 chromosome was detected. Only intraspecific variation was found in heterochromatic block markings in the sex chromosomes and autosomes in the two populations of both species at each location.<br>Pela técnica do bandamento C detectou-se variação de marcação dos blocos heterocromáticos dos cromossomos de A. darlingi e A. nuneztovari de Manaus, Amazonas, e de Macapá, Amapá, Brasil. Os cromossomos sexuais de ambas as espécies mostraram duas formas de cromossomos X e o Y foi totalmente heterocromático. No cromossomo X1 de A. darlingi a marcação atingiu 1/3 e no cromossomo X2 foi apenas na região centromérica. Nos autossomos de ambas as espécies as marcações foram constantes nas regiões centroméricas, e o cromossomo II de A. darlingi mostrou um bloco heterocromático em um dos braços. A. nuneztovari mostrou polimorfismo de tamanho para o cromossomo X, tendo o X maior (X1) três blocos e o menor (X2) dois blocos heterocromáticos. Fêmeas homozigotas (X2X2) não foram detectadas nas duas localidades. Em machos de A. darlingi foram encontrados os cromossomos X1 e X2, enquanto que em machos de A. nuneztovari somente o cromossomo X1 foi detectado. Apenas variação intraespecífica de blocos heterocromáticos nos cromossomos X e nos autossomos foi registrada nas duas populações de ambas as espécies estudadas em cada localidade.
